I restricted in-game voice, and voice/text messages to friends only. I know I'm going to miss out on a few genuinely cool people, such as the ones I've met randomly and kept on my friends list for years, but I think my everyday experience is going to be better without the screaming/singing/trash talk/complaining.
If you are interested in doing this, follow the below instructions:
Open the left blade with a single press of the guide button after signing in
Select your gamertag
Edit profile
Privacy Settings
Voice and Text
The rest is intuitive
I'm quoting that from memory, so something may be slightly off, but it should get you there if you're interested.
